The resort does seem to be the most up market in the area but it has a long way to go before it rates as well as a 5 star resort at say, Fiji. The rooms are nice but are not regularly deep cleaned. Washing machine and shower frames all dirty. The beds are terrible, I asked for a new mattress but it was no better. They are noisy with any movement, you can feel the springs and they are very firm. The shower head holder in my room was broken, reported it and maintenance replaced the head but left the actual broken part, so still no good, but I gave up on it and used as is. The staff are mostly lovely, I liked the waiters and the activity team, but some of the managers are not very friendly. I asked for a banana at breakfast, waiter had to ask the chef. The chef came out with the bananas and gave me an absolute filthy look over it ( im not sure why?). I have found that although the activity staff as nice guys alot of the activities dont go ahead or aren't really advertised when starting. For example every day pool volleyball is advertised, a net was never put up. Food is ok, but takes a long time to be served and several times parts of our orders were missed. One manager made me provide a receipt for missed fries as he didn't believe I had paid for them, yet he wasnt even there when I ordered. Main pool has some lining missing from the bottom, 5 star resort should have this fixed. The resort would benefit having waiters work the pool decks for drink orders saves us going to bar

Overall: A relaxing stay with great airport access, but service needs some tightening up.
The Room: Spacious and clean, though the floor in our initial room (we stayed there twice due to our arrival and departure times) felt like it needed a good mop. I missed the complimentary slippers the previous Sheraton management used to provide, but otherwise, it was a good space.
Amenities & Atmosphere: Great, relaxing vibe. The beach and pool are both lovely. They did run out of pool towels due to how busy it was, resulting in a bit of a wait. We also checked out the casino for the first time and appreciated the good deals they offered.
Dining & Service: The food was decent, but the wait staff operations need improvement. Our order was misplaced, and three tables that arrived after us were served first. It took me speaking up to get things moving. Despite having plenty of staff on the floor, there was a lack of consistent follow-up with tables.
Location: Highly recommended for its proximity to the airport - very handy for early morning flights or late check-ins.

Beautiful location with little beach and rock pools for exploring. Pool was dated and unappealing. Great bar on the waters edge with sunset views. Buffet dinner and show was overpriced and boring. Did offer some free activities like crab racing, movies and church excursions. Room was ok but had no ambience and was dated with some things needing replacing like our rusty clothes airer. Food and room expensive for what we got and that was without breakfast included. Did get a small welcome drink on arrival.
